ASG Premier (Ages 13-18)

ASG Premier

ASG Florida offers committed players the opportunity to develop their skills, their understanding of the game, and to compete at the highest level of play. ASG competitive teams will travel, when necessary, to seek this premium level of play; because of its educational value and belief that soccer improvement is born of superior competition. Teams train twice weekly with professionally licensed coaches following a unique educational curriculum designed to maximize development, growth while still being fun. Teams play in the highest level of league, in-state, intra-state, cup, tournament and national competition available today.

Frequently asked questions

1) How much travel is involved with each team?

Each team belongs to the same league (I-10 League) and plays teams within that league ranging from JAX to Pensacola. Most tournaments are on average 3-4 hours away with the exception of regional tournaments. Teams typically travel to one possibly 2 tournaments a month. 

2) How much does competitive soccer cost?

ASG competitive teams are split into two payments a season. ASG training fees covers administrative fees, specialty fees and coach’s fees which typically cost between $350-$395 a season. ASG team fees which are fees associated with your actual team range depending on sponsorships, size of the team and the amount of time your team travels. This cost is typically around $350.

3) How do we order uniforms?

Once teams have been established, Cyndi Boswell will allow you to choose (based on availability your child’s number). From that she will send you a link to soccer.com to order your uniforms. Our club required uniforms are red and white tops, black shorts and red and black socks. Each team has the options to choose a black and yellow tops and red shorts in addition to the required set.
